US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"is realized as a"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e how something is understood, perceived, or manifested in a particular form or manner. Example: "In this context, the concept is realized as a fundamental principle of design."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

When using "is realized as a", ensure the sentence clearly explains the relationship between the abstract concept and its concrete manifestation. For instance, specify what the concept becomes in practice.

Common error

Avoid using "is realized as a" without specifying how something becomes what you're describing. For example, instead of saying "The plan is realized as a strategy", clarify: "The plan is realized as a detailed strategy with specific milestones".

FAQs

How can I use "is realized as a" in a sentence?

Use "is realized as a" to explain how an abstract concept manifests in a concrete form. For example, "The theoretical model /s/is+realized+as+a functional prototype".

What are some alternatives to "is realized as a"?

You can use alternatives like "is manifested as a", "is expressed as a", or "is embodied as a" depending on the context.

Is there a difference between "is realized as a" and "is implemented as a"?

"Is implemented as a" emphasizes the practical execution of something, while "is realized as a" is a more general term that encompasses both the conceptual and practical aspects of manifestation.

When is it appropriate to use "is realized as a" in writing?

It's appropriate to use "is realized as a" when you want to explain how an idea, plan, or concept takes shape in a tangible or understandable form.
